Risk factors in a rate-sensitive environment

As a REIT, CTO Realty Growth is exposed to interest-rate and financing risk, given that higher benchmark yields increase borrowing costs and can reduce the relative attractiveness of dividend income compared with risk-free alternatives; this rate sensitivity is one reason why REIT share prices such as CTO often move more sharply when rate expectations change.

For investors, the key question is how efficiently CTO Realty Growth can pass through rent increases, maintain occupancy and recycle capital into higher-yielding assets so that property-level cash flows offset any increase in interest expense, a balance that ultimately drives both earnings performance and the sustainability of shareholder distributions.
